cnc-support-forum
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.
-45%
Le deal à ne pas rater :
PC Portable LG Gram 17″ Intel Evo Core i7 32 Go /1 To
1099.99 € 1999.99 €
Voir le deal

Aller en bas
avatar
Admin
Admin
Messages : 23
Date d'inscription : 12/03/2023
https://cnc-support.forumactif.com

Liste de Fonctions Macro disponibles Empty Liste de Fonctions Macro disponibles

Mer 22 Nov 2023 - 10:15
Je vais essayer de tenir à jour une liste des macros qui existent pour chaque type de machine ( Tours, Centres , Multi-Fonctions ).
Précisant si une interface "Add-In" est déjà développée : Une interface Add-In est l'Ajout d'une Unité Mazatrol spécifique qui permet d'appeler un sous-programme Macro, avec l'appel des arguments pré-rempli et un support d'entrée des valeurs exactement comme la programmation d'une unité Mazatrol standard :
( question support dans la zone de dialogue habituelle, écran Aide, Etc..)

Fonction : Interpolation Hélicoïdale Conique Inter/Exter
Add-In : Oui
**** Liste des Arguments ****
( D Diametre Départ )
( Z Z Départ )
( B Diametre final )
( W Z final )
( X centre X)
( Y centre Y)
( A Ap : Pas z par tour )
( I Distance d’accostage/dégagement Radial en X )
( V Vcc m/min )
( F F mm/tour )
( M Arrosage 8.9.51 )
( T Type 1=Inter 2=Exter )
( E sens G2 G3 > G2=Horaire-Droite G3=Anti-Horaire-Gauche )
( S Z Plan Initial )

Notes / Remarques :
Usine forcément du haut vers le bas ( Z > W )
Permet usinage hélicoïdal d'un Alesage, cylindrique ou Conique, avec ou sans fond plat
Dégagement radial en fin d'interpolation de valeur I mm en X ( pas forcement retour à l'axe Alesage )
Permet détourage d'un cylindre ou Cone Exter
Permet Filetage Inter ou Exter (pas de fond plat) , Cylindrique ou Conique , à Droite ou à Gauche , mais toujours en descente
Permet aussi fraisage d'une rainure circulaire ( Retrait I=0 )

avatar
Admin
Admin
Messages : 23
Date d'inscription : 12/03/2023
https://cnc-support.forumactif.com

Liste de Fonctions Macro disponibles Empty Re: Liste de Fonctions Macro disponibles

Mer 22 Nov 2023 - 10:43
Voici un Aperçu de cette fonction en Add-In :
Le choix de l'Unité ' Cone Helicoidal' affiche cette Unité telle que l'image.
Le curseur parcours ensuite les cases à remplir avec un petit texte de support / mémento dans la zone de dialogue ( ici Dia Départ )
Liste de Fonctions Macro disponibles Cone-u11

Fichiers d’installation et notice d'utilisation à disposition en Zone Abonnés VIP.


Dernière édition par Admin le Sam 25 Nov 2023 - 20:01, édité 1 fois
avatar
Admin
Admin
Messages : 23
Date d'inscription : 12/03/2023
https://cnc-support.forumactif.com

Liste de Fonctions Macro disponibles Empty Re: Liste de Fonctions Macro disponibles

Sam 25 Nov 2023 - 20:00
Fonction : Fraisage de Filets par interpolation hélicoïdale

Quasi équivalente à la fonction d'interpolation hélicoïdale présentée au-dessus.
Différence : Cette fonction-ci permet de démarrer du fond pour remonter (Filetage à droite en avalant) que ne permet pas la fonction précédente.

La présente fonction permet des Interpolations Hélicoïdales pour réalisation de filetages par fraisage.
Possible en Intérieur ou Extérieur, En montant ou en descendant.
Il n'y a pas de tour à Z constant en fin d’hélice.
La différence entre Z départ et Z fin doit être un multiple du pas :
Ajuster le Z de début ou de fin pour respecter cette condition.
Le Diamètre de fin peut être différent de celui de Départ ( Filetage Conique )


Liste des Arguments

( D       Diametre Départ )
( Z       Z Départ )
( B       Diametre final )
( W     Z final )
( X      centre X)
( Y      centre Y)
( A       Pas du Filet )
( I      Distance d’accostage/dégagement Radial en X )
( V     Vcc  m/min )
( F       F mm/tour )
( M     Arrosage 8.9.51 )
( T      Type 1=Inter 2=Exter )
( E      sens G2 G3  >  G2=Horaire-Droite   G3=Anti-Horaire-Gauche )
( S      Z Plan Initial  )

Voici comment se présente cette Unité lorsqu'elle est utilisée dans un programme Mazatrol :
Liste de Fonctions Macro disponibles Unit-f10

Voici en exemple la programmation d'un M20*150 partant de Z-15 et remontant jusqu'à Z0.
Liste de Fonctions Macro disponibles Sample10


Fichiers d’installation et notice d'utilisation à disposition en Zone Abonnés VIP.
avatar
Admin
Admin
Messages : 23
Date d'inscription : 12/03/2023
https://cnc-support.forumactif.com

Liste de Fonctions Macro disponibles Empty Re: Liste de Fonctions Macro disponibles

Sam 25 Nov 2023 - 20:17
Fonction : Recalcul des Origines pièces après Rotation d'un Axe Rotatif

Sur les centres d'usinages sur lesquels sont rapportés un diviseur (4° axe, ou 4+5° axe), on cherche souvent à usiner plusieurs faces lors de la même opération.
Sur les centres 5 axes, il existe des fonctions pour que la machine retrouve son origine pièce dans l'espace machine après rotations de ses axes.
C'est le CDP Dec en Mazatrol.
Une telle fonction est bien pratique : gain de temps en réglage, suppression de l'incertitude de pinulage, etc..

Nous avons développé ce type de fonction, pour toute les configurations possible (Axe A, Axe B, Axe C, A+C , B+C)

Principe de fonctionnement :
On indique quelle repère est celui de la pièce au départ (G54>G59 ou G54.1P1>G54.1P300)
le déplacement de ce point dans le repère X,Y,Z initial
Les angles de rotation du/des axes rotatifs
Un nouveau déplacement selon X,Y,Z après la rotation (appliqué sur le repère d'arrivée)
Le numéro du repère dans lequel je veux écrire le résultat (G54>G59 ou G54.1P1>G54.1P300)

Il ne reste plus qu'à activer le repère écrit, positionner mes axes rotatifs et programmer mes usinages sur le plan incliné.

Aperçu de l'Unité en Add-In Mazatrol :
Liste de Fonctions Macro disponibles Cdpdec10

Les coordonnées du point pivot sont indiqués dans le programme Macro :
A renseigner à la mise en oeuvre initiale.

Fichiers d'installation, exemples, notices utilisateur accessible en zone Abonnés VIP
Contenu sponsorisé

Liste de Fonctions Macro disponibles Empty Re: Liste de Fonctions Macro disponibles

Revenir en haut
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um